Wisconsin Cybercrime Research Hub

In Wisconsin, the increasing prevalence of cybercrime poses significant challenges across critical industries, particularly in agriculture and manufacturing, which are the backbone of the state's economy. According to the Federal Bureau of Investigation (FBI), Wisconsin experienced a surge in cybercrime incidents over the past five years, leading to estimated financial losses exceeding $50 million annually. The state's diverse industrial landscape, combined with a workforce that lacks specialized cybersecurity training, highlights the urgent need for targeted interventions designed to bolster defenses against these virtual threats.

Local businesses, especially smaller firms based in rural communities, face unique vulnerabilities when it comes to cyber threats. Many of these organizations often lack the resources and infrastructure necessary to implement comprehensive cybersecurity measures. A recent survey indicated that over 60% of small-to-midsize enterprises in Wisconsin have no formal cybersecurity training or protocols in place, making them prime targets for cybercriminals. Furthermore, the geographical distribution of the population, with a greater concentration in urban areas compared to rural outposts, complicates the outreach and support initiatives necessary for effective cybersecurity education and prevention.

The establishment of the Wisconsin Cybercrime Research Hub directly addresses these challenges by creating a specialized center aimed at conducting extensive research on the specific cyber threats plaguing the state’s dominant industries. This hub will focus on generating actionable insights and tailored preventative measures, specifically designed to enhance the cybersecurity protocols of local businesses. By partnering with industry experts and academic institutions, the center will conduct proactive analyses of emerging threats while disseminating findings to ensure that Wisconsin's workforce remains well-informed and prepared.

Additionally, the hub aims to facilitate collaboration among law enforcement agencies, private sector organizations, and technology professionals. Such partnerships will enhance the ability to respond to cyber incidents in a timely manner, thereby reinforcing the overall cybersecurity posture of the state. With a focus on actionable strategies, the hub will deliver workshops and training sessions that address the specific needs of Wisconsin's agricultural and manufacturing sectors, thereby helping organizations implement robust defenses against possible cyber intrusions.

In conclusion, as Wisconsin continues to grapple with the complexities of cybercrime, the Cybercrime Research Hub serves as a pivotal resource for the state’s industries. By focusing on localized strategies and targeted training resources, this initiative is poised to significantly enhance the cybersecurity landscape within Wisconsin’s agricultural and manufacturing sectors, directly contributing to both economic growth and security.
